Remove-Item: potential v6 regression on path like Function:\Global:* #4330

Steps to reproduce

    # works
    $null = New-Item Function:\Global:Test-Me -Value '"Test-Me1"'
    Test-Me

    # works
    Set-Item Function:\Global:Test-Me -Value '"Test-Me2"'
    Test-Me

    # works in v2-v5, fails in v6
    Remove-Item Function:\Global:Test-Me

Expected behavior

Remove-Item Function:\Global:Test-Me removes the specified global function in v6,
like it does in v2-v5.

Actual behavior

Remove-Item Function:\Global:Test-Me fails in v6:

    Remove-Item : The given path's format is not supported.

Environment data

    Name                           Value
    ----                           -----
    PSVersion                      6.0.0-beta
    PSEdition                      Core
    GitCommitId                    v6.0.0-beta.4
    OS                             Microsoft Windows 10.0.10586
    Platform                       Win32NT
    PSCompatibleVersions           {1.0, 2.0, 3.0, 4.0...}
    PSRemotingProtocolVersion      2.3
    SerializationVersion           1.1.0.1
    WSManStackVersion              3.0
